How to Develop a Fantasy Cricket App That Stands Out in a Competitive Market

The fantasy sports industry, particularly fantasy cricket, has seen tremendous growth in recent years. As the competition intensifies, developing a fantasy cricket app that stands out in a crowded market requires a strategic approach. From innovative features to effective marketing strategies, this guide will walk you through the essential steps to create a unique and successful fantasy cricket app.

Understanding the Fantasy Cricket App Market

Before diving into development, it’s crucial to understand the current market landscape. Fantasy cricket apps have gained popularity due to their interactive nature, offering users a chance to create their dream teams and compete in real-time. With major tournaments like the Indian Premier League (IPL) attracting millions of viewers, the demand for fantasy cricket apps has surged. However, this popularity also means that the market is highly competitive, with numerous apps vying for user attention.

Key Features to Make Your Fantasy Cricket App Stand Out

To differentiate your fantasy cricket app from competitors, focus on integrating unique and valuable features that enhance user experience. Here are some essential features to consider:

  1. Intuitive User Interface (UI) and Experience (UX)

    A seamless and user-friendly interface is crucial for user retention. Your app should have an intuitive design that allows users to easily navigate through different sections, such as team creation, contests, and match updates. Invest in a clean and attractive UI that appeals to both casual and serious cricket fans.

  2. Real-Time Data Integration

    Fantasy cricket apps rely heavily on real-time data to provide accurate player statistics and match updates. Integrate APIs that offer live score updates, player performance metrics, and match insights. This ensures that users have the latest information to make informed decisions and adjust their teams accordingly.

  3. Customizable Contests and Leagues

    Allow users to create and join customizable contests and leagues. Offering various contest formats, such as head-to-head matches, private leagues, and mega contests, caters to different preferences. Providing options for users to create private leagues with friends or colleagues adds a social element that can increase user engagement.

  4. Advanced Analytics and Insights

    Incorporate advanced analytics tools to help users make data-driven decisions. Provide insights into player performance trends, historical data, and predictive analytics. Users appreciate features that offer a competitive edge, such as player recommendations based on statistical analysis and historical performance.

  5. Gamification Elements

    Gamification can significantly enhance user engagement. Introduce elements such as leaderboards, achievements, badges, and rewards to keep users motivated. Leaderboards that display top performers and milestone achievements can create a sense of competition and encourage users to participate more actively.

  6. Augmented Reality (AR) and Virtual Reality (VR)

    AR and VR technologies can provide an immersive experience for users. While AR can overlay live statistics and player information during matches, VR can offer virtual stadium tours or interactive game scenarios. These technologies can set your app apart by providing unique and engaging experiences.

  7. Social Media Integration

    Integrating social media features allows users to share their achievements, invite friends, and participate in referral programs. Social media integration not only enhances user engagement but also serves as a marketing tool to attract new users. Implement features that let users post their teams, match predictions, and contest results on social platforms.

  8. Secure Payment Gateway

    A secure and reliable payment gateway is essential for handling transactions within the app. Ensure that users can easily deposit entry fees, withdraw winnings, and make in-app purchases. Offer multiple payment options, such as credit/debit cards, digital wallets, and UPI, to accommodate different user preferences.

  9. Multi-Language and Regional Support

    Catering to a diverse user base requires multi-language support. Offer your app in various languages to appeal to users from different regions. Additionally, incorporating regional cricketing information and player stats can make the app more relevant to users from specific locations.

  10. Robust Customer Support

    Efficient customer support is critical for resolving user issues and maintaining satisfaction. Provide multiple channels for customer support, including in-app chat, email, and a comprehensive FAQ section. Responsive and helpful support can enhance the overall user experience and build trust in your app.

Collaborating with a Fantasy Cricket App Development Company

Partnering with a reputable fantasy cricket app development company is crucial for turning your vision into reality. Here’s how to choose the right development partner:

  1. Experience and Expertise

    Look for a development company with a proven track record in creating top  fantasy cricket apps. Review their portfolio and case studies to assess their expertise in building similar applications. An experienced company will understand the nuances of fantasy sports and can provide valuable insights during the development process.

  2. Technical Skills

    Ensure that the development company has the technical skills required to implement advanced features such as real-time data integration, AR/VR, and secure payment gateways. The company should have expertise in various technologies, including mobile app development, backend development, and API integration.

  3. User-Centric Approach

    Choose a company that prioritizes user experience and design. They should focus on creating an intuitive and engaging app that meets user expectations. A user-centric approach ensures that the app not only functions well but also resonates with the target audience.

  4. Transparency and Communication

    Effective communication is key to a successful development project. Select a company that provides regular updates, maintains transparency in their processes, and is responsive to your feedback. Clear communication helps in aligning the development process with your goals and expectations.

  5. Post-Launch Support and Maintenance

    Development doesn’t end with the app launch. Ensure that the company offers post-launch support and maintenance services. Regular updates, bug fixes, and feature enhancements are essential for keeping the app functional and competitive.

Cost Considerations for Developing a Fantasy Cricket App

Developing a fantasy cricket app involves various cost factors. Understanding these costs will help you budget effectively and avoid unexpected expenses. Key cost considerations include:

  1. App Complexity and Features

    The complexity of the app and the features you want to include will significantly impact the cost. Advanced features such as AR/VR, AI-driven analytics, and real-time data integration will increase development costs. Clearly define your feature set to get accurate cost estimates from your development partner.

  2. Development Team and Location

    The rates of your development team can vary based on their location and expertise. Companies in countries like the US or UK typically charge higher rates compared to those in regions like India or Eastern Europe. Balance cost with quality to ensure you get a well-developed app.

  3. Design and User Interface

    Investing in high-quality design and user interface is crucial for the app’s success. A professional design team can enhance the app’s appeal and usability, but it may also add to the development cost. Consider the long-term benefits of a well-designed app when budgeting for design expenses.

  4. Backend Development and Infrastructure

    Backend development involves setting up servers, databases, and APIs to support the app’s functionality. The complexity of backend development and the infrastructure required will affect the overall cost. Plan for scalable and reliable infrastructure to handle user traffic and data.

  5. Testing and Quality Assurance

    Thorough testing and quality assurance are essential to deliver a bug-free app. Allocate a budget for comprehensive testing, including functionality, usability, performance, and security testing. Investing in QA services ensures a smooth user experience and reduces the risk of post-launch issues.

  6. Maintenance and Updates

    Post-launch maintenance and updates are ongoing costs that should be factored into your budget. Regular updates, bug fixes, and feature enhancements are necessary to keep the app relevant and functional. Plan for these ongoing expenses to ensure the app’s long-term success.

Conclusion

Developing a fantasy cricket app that stands out in a competitive market requires a combination of innovative features, user-centric design, and strategic development. By focusing on key features such as real-time data integration, advanced analytics, and gamification, you can create an engaging and unique app experience. Partnering with a reputable fantasy cricket app development company ensures that your vision is brought to life with expertise and professionalism. Understanding cost considerations and managing your budget effectively will contribute to the overall success and sustainability of your fantasy cricket app. With the right approach, you can create an app that captivates users and thrives in the competitive fantasy sports market.

Posted in Default Category on September 04 2024 at 07:39 PM

Comments (0)

No login